Visitors to the National Museum of Scotland this week can enjoy a variety of animal-themed activities inspired by the Wildlife Photographer of the Year exhibitionthanks to players of People’s Postcode Lottery.

 Sadie and Stella Smith aged 6 & 9 explore the Animal World Gallery at the National Museum of Scotland, Chambers Street with the help of Joanna Laird, Programmes Assistant, People’s Postcode Lottery.
 

Wild Things February Half Term is a week of activities at the National Museum of Scotland supported by funding from players of People’s Postcode Lottery, including Gallery Safaris, Selfie Safari Trails and Meet the Expert sessions which will encourage children to explore the galleries and make new discoveries.

Wild Things February Half Term runs until Friday 16 February 2018.
